What causes bloating?

Regular bloating can be caused by constipation, coeliac disease, food intolerances, usually to gluten, wheat or milk (lactose intolerance), and ir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), according to healthdirect.gov.au, 2020. Eating a lot of salty food and carbohydrates, as well as swallowing air when you eat too fast or drink a lot of fizzy drinks can also cause bloating.

Can eating foods high in FODMAPs cause bloating?

Eating foods high in FODMAPs can cause bloating, especially for people with IBS, as noted by Sass on womenshealthmag.com in 2019. Garlic is a common seasoning that can lead to bloating if consumed in large quantities.

Overeating is the most common cause of bloating, according to WebMD (2020), and reducing portion sizes can help ease the discomfort. Eating fatty foods can also make one feel uncomfortably full as fat takes longer to digest than other kinds of food.
